@@ -0,0 +1,108 @@
+use crate::{
+ canvas::{Frame, Geometry},
+ Primitive,
+};
+
+use iced_native::Size;
+use std::{cell::RefCell, sync::Arc};
+
+enum State {
+ Empty,
+ Filled {
+ bounds: Size,
+ primitive: Arc<Primitive>,
+ },
+}
+
+impl Default for State {
+ fn default() -> Self {
+ State::Empty
+ }
+}
+/// A simple cache that stores generated [`Geometry`] to avoid recomputation.
+///
+/// A [`Cache`] will not redraw its geometry unless the dimensions of its layer
+/// change or it is explicitly cleared.
+///
+/// [`Layer`]: ../trait.Layer.html
+/// [`Cache`]: struct.Cache.html
+/// [`Geometry`]: struct.Geometry.html
+#[derive(Debug, Default)]
+pub struct Cache {
+ state: RefCell<State>,
+}
+
+impl Cache {
+ /// Creates a new empty [`Cache`].
+ ///
+ /// [`Cache`]: struct.Cache.html
+ pub fn new() -> Self {
+ Cache {
+ state: Default::default(),
+ }
+ }
+
+ /// Clears the [`Cache`], forcing a redraw the next time it is used.
+ ///
+ /// [`Cache`]: struct.Cache.html
+ pub fn clear(&mut self) {
+ *self.state.borrow_mut() = State::Empty;
+ }
+
+ /// Draws [`Geometry`] using the provided closure and stores it in the
+ /// [`Cache`].
+ ///
+ /// The closure will only be called when
+ /// - the bounds have changed since the previous draw call.
+ /// - the [`Cache`] is empty or has been explicitly cleared.
+ ///
+ /// Otherwise, the previously stored [`Geometry`] will be returned. The
+ /// [`Cache`] is not cleared in this case. In other words, it will keep
+ /// returning the stored [`Geometry`] if needed.
+ ///
+ /// [`Cache`]: struct.Cache.html
+ pub fn draw(&self, bounds: Size, draw_fn: impl Fn(&mut Frame)) -> Geometry {
+ use std::ops::Deref;
+
+ if let State::Filled {
+ bounds: cached_bounds,
+ primitive,
+ } = self.state.borrow().deref()
+ {
+ if *cached_bounds == bounds {
+ return Geometry::from_primitive(Primitive::Cached {
+ cache: primitive.clone(),
+ });
+ }
+ }
+
+ let mut frame = Frame::new(bounds);
+ draw_fn(&mut frame);
+
+ let primitive = {
+ let geometry = frame.into_geometry();
+
+ Arc::new(geometry.into_primitive())
+ };
+
+ *self.state.borrow_mut() = State::Filled {
+ bounds,
+ primitive: primitive.clone(),
+ };
+
+ Geometry::from_primitive(Primitive::Cached { cache: primitive })
+ }
+}
+
+impl std::fmt::Debug for State {
+ fn fmt(&self, f: &mut std::fmt::Formatter<'_>) -> std::fmt::Result {
+ match self {
+ State::Empty => write!(f, "Empty"),
+ State::Filled { primitive, bounds } => f
+ .debug_struct("Filled")
+ .field("primitive", primitive)
+ .field("bounds", bounds)
+ .finish(),
+ }
+ }
+}

@@ -0,0 +1,85 @@
+use crate::canvas::{Cursor, Event, Geometry};
+use iced_native::{mouse, Rectangle};
+
+/// The state and logic of a [`Canvas`].
+///
+/// A [`Program`] can mutate internal state and produce messages for an
+/// application.
+///
+/// [`Canvas`]: struct.Canvas.html
+/// [`Program`]: trait.Program.html
+pub trait Program<Message> {
+ /// Updates the state of the [`Program`].
+ ///
+ /// When a [`Program`] is used in a [`Canvas`], the runtime will call this
+ /// method for each [`Event`].
+ ///
+ /// This method can optionally return a `Message` to notify an application
+ /// of any meaningful interactions.
+ ///
+ /// By default, this method does and returns nothing.
+ ///
+ /// [`Program`]: trait.Program.html
+ /// [`Canvas`]: struct.Canvas.html
+ /// [`Event`]: enum.Event.html
+ fn update(
+ &mut self,
+ _event: Event,
+ _bounds: Rectangle,
+ _cursor: Cursor,
+ ) -> Option<Message> {
+ None
+ }
+
+ /// Draws the state of the [`Program`], producing a bunch of [`Geometry`].
+ ///
+ /// [`Geometry`] can be easily generated with a [`Frame`] or stored in a
+ /// [`Cache`].
+ ///
+ /// [`Program`]: trait.Program.html
+ /// [`Geometry`]: struct.Geometry.html
+ /// [`Frame`]: struct.Frame.html
+ /// [`Cache`]: struct.Cache.html
+ fn draw(&self, bounds: Rectangle, cursor: Cursor) -> Vec<Geometry>;
+
+ /// Returns the current mouse interaction of the [`Program`].
+ ///
+ /// The interaction returned will be in effect even if the cursor position
+ /// is out of bounds of the program's [`Canvas`].
+ ///
+ /// [`Program`]: trait.Program.html
+ /// [`Canvas`]: struct.Canvas.html
+ fn mouse_interaction(
+ &self,
+ _bounds: Rectangle,
+ _cursor: Cursor,
+ ) -> mouse::Interaction {
+ mouse::Interaction::default()
+ }
+}
+
+impl<T, Message> Program<Message> for &mut T
+where
+ T: Program<Message>,
+{
+ fn update(
+ &mut self,
+ event: Event,
+ bounds: Rectangle,
+ cursor: Cursor,
+ ) -> Option<Message> {
+ T::update(self, event, bounds, cursor)
+ }
+
+ fn draw(&self, bounds: Rectangle, cursor: Cursor) -> Vec<Geometry> {
+ T::draw(self, bounds, cursor)
+ }
+
+ fn mouse_interaction(
+ &self,
+ bounds: Rectangle,
+ cursor: Cursor,
+ ) -> mouse::Interaction {
+ T::mouse_interaction(self, bounds, cursor)
+ }
+}
